This is the first class in a two-part series celebrating the New England apple. In class, we'll prepare a classic Chausson aux Pommes.

The class focuses on a French viennoiserie classic: the chausson aux pommes — otherwise known as a French apple turnover. Made with delicate puff pastry and tart, freshly picked New England apples, this dish is a welcome addition to any breakfast or Thanksgiving table. In this three-hour class, you will learn how to prepare the puff pastry dough, folding in a block of butter to make delicate layers of dough. You will then prepare a sweet apple filling. You will leave class with your very own pastries and the knowledge needed to recreate the treats at home.
